## Service Accounts — StormFan Alert Fan-Out

The fan-out worker authenticates to the internal dispatch tier using the svc-stormfan account. Rotate quarterly; scopes are limited to publish-only on alert topics. If deliveries stall during your shift, verify the worker is using the current credential, reproduced below for reference.

API key for kaweg-hahif: kto4_rAjZ

**Q: How does Grainfall handle monthly table partitions for plugin data?**

Grainfall partitions all plugin-owned tables by calendar month, UTC. Your plugin must not create partitions manually; the Vexler scheduler provisions them three days ahead. Queries spanning more than six partitions are rejected unless you set the wide-scan flag. Dropped partitions are archived for 90 days in the Holtmere cold store. To restore archived partition data, open the recovery console and authenticate with the passphrase below.

strongbox words: prawyn-fenmir

## Environments and wiki access

Welcome to the Brambleport team! Our wiki uses role-based access: viewers can read everything, editors can touch staging pages, and only maintainers edit the prod environment pages. Don't panic if a page looks locked — ask any maintainer for a bump. Each environment page carries the service's current config, starting with these values.

deployment values, kajep-kageg:
[praix]
host = praix.paliqcorp.corp
user = praix_svc
database = praix_prod